Output 66c63029b424c683a7cbab8f17e064beb34d9243572c87bcb5af993aec281ffb:1

value
287496
script pubkey
OP_0 OP_PUSHBYTES_20 c60f3eb33dc19b439a8b580ced92decb9631ecc2
address
ltc1qcc8naveacxd58x5ttqxwmyk7ewtrrmxz7llp4c
transaction
66c63029b424c683a7cbab8f17e064beb34d9243572c87bcb5af993aec281ffb
spent
true